DURATION

Cave visits last 75 minutes. The course, which is equipped and easy to access, is 1,500 metres long.

GUIDES

Groups are accompanied by professional guides provided by the Consorzio Frasassi.

TEMPERATURE

The temperature inside is a constant 14 °C. We recommend you wear a pullover and comfortable shoes.

Heart patients

The visit is not recommended for heart patients

Footwear

The path is slippery at times, we recommend the use of comfortable non-slip footwear

LIMITED MOBILITY

For visitors with limited mobility access is possible until the beginning of the second room , the room 200

Disabled people in wheelchairs

Access to disabled people in wheelchairs is only possible in the first room. There is also the possibility of two disabled parking spaces at the entrance to the caves, which can only be used by those in possession of an exposed coupon.

Strollers

Access to the path is possible with strollers only in the first room, to continue with the baby we recommend a baby carrier

Toilet

It is recommended to use the toilet before the visit

ClOSING DAYS

Caves and Museums closed on 4 December, 25 December and from 10 to 30 January inclusive.

Languages

In case of foreign language people, you can download the free AudioGuide Grotte di Frasassi app, where you can listen to all the information and curiosities inside the caves at each check point. English language tours are also available throughout the day. Go to the ticket office to find out the times scheduled for that day.

Parking and ticket office at the entrance to the Frasassi Caves

The main car park is located at the ticket office of the Caves, in La Cuna - Genga station, where a camper area is also set up. A shuttle is available to customers for transfers from the ticket office to the entrance to the caves. The caves can also be reached on foot (distance 1.3 km).

Public Parks

In the hamlet of San Vittore a short walk from the caves near the abbey there is a public park with games and benches.
